| fatherland | | |
| n. (location) | 1. country of origin, fatherland, homeland, mother country, motherland, native land | the country where you were born. |
| ~ country, land, state | the territory occupied by a nation.; "he returned to the land of his birth"; "he visited several European countries" |
| ~ old country | the country of origin of an immigrant. |
| thicket | | |
| n. (group) | 1. brush, brushwood, coppice, copse, thicket | a dense growth of bushes. |
| ~ botany, flora, vegetation | all the plant life in a particular region or period.; "Pleistocene vegetation"; "the flora of southern California"; "the botany of China" |
| ~ brake | an area thickly overgrown usually with one kind of plant. |
| ~ canebrake | a dense growth of cane (especially giant cane). |
| ~ spinney | a copse that shelters game. |
| ~ underbrush, undergrowth, underwood | the brush (small trees and bushes and ferns etc.) growing beneath taller trees in a wood or forest. |
